To: Parks and Recreation Commission
From: Michael Hecker,Parks and Recreation Director
Date: September 10,2013
Subject: Capital Improvement Fund 2014 Project Descriptions
Attached is the Park Improvement Fund spreadsheet with the projects recommended by staff for 2014.
The projects are funded by the liquor store profits at a level of 45% as recommended by City Council in
2013. The main purpose of the fund is to maintain what we currently have in our park system. Below
are the brief descriptions for each project (as recommended by staff in priority order):
#1 Parks Master Plan $45,000
A park and recreation master plan is needed to assess the current status of our parks and recreation
services and resources and provide a strategic analysis of our strengths, opportunities and future needs.
It will become a road map to guide decisions and direct priorities. This was approved last year by the
Commission and City Council.
Current for 2014 but amount increased to $45,000 from $35,000 because of timing.
#2 Parks Master Plan Needs Assessment $15,000
The needs assessment is a bid alternate to the overall parks master plan. It will be a survey that will
represent a sampling of the community population to identify community needs and issues on the park
and recreation programs and facilities.
New for 2014
#3 Trail repairs and connections $100,000
Many of our trails in the city have met their life expectancy and are in need of repairs and or
replacement. The priority for 2014 will be Orono Park and the Orono Parkway.
This is an annual expenditure in the Fund
#4 Playground Safety $6,000
The funds are used to add playground wood fiber to the playgrounds each year to make them safe.
This is an annual expenditure in the Fund
#5 Orono Park Improvements $51,000
This project will maintain the use and increase safety/security of Orono Park Playground. It includes
security lighting around the perimeter of the playground with security cameras added to the light poles.
Cameras are recommended by staff based on the recent increase in accidents and to prevent
vandalism/incidents. Also, included in this project are trees and then irrigation for the new trees and

new grass areas around the playground. The trees will be placed around the perimeter of the
playground/benches needed for future shade.
A double see saw with a higher load capacity will be installed to replace the current seesaw. Orono Park
is in need of new ADA vandal resistant picnic tables for the shelters. A total of 14- ADA compliant
picnic tables will replace the current tables that will be installed in other parks.
New for 2014
#6 YAC well and irrigation $35,000
The additional well and irrigation will provide more efficient watering turf and trees. It will allow to
time to water during the early morning hours when there is less wind and sun to compete with and the
additional irrigation will water areas not currently irrigated along with trees. The irrigation of trees will
provide the needed water on a regular basis and will require less staff time
Current- This project has been pushed off each year for the past two years.
#7 Orono Park Health Beat $18,000
We are requested by residents to continue health and wellness family fun and a sense of community with
a comprehensive balanced workout at Orono Park. We already have a stair stepper in the Health Beat
system that was part of the original playground. This project will include an area concrete pad near the
new playground for an overall Health Beat system and two pieces of equipment in the line- a chest back
press and an Ab crunch leg lift. Additional systems will be added on the concrete pad in additional
years.
New for 2014.
#8 Dog Park irrigation and trees- $6,000
Installing irrigation and trees will provide users a much more pleasant environment to enjoy their time
with other park user and their pets. The irrigation will assist with maintaining a healthy turf and provide
sufficient water for the newly planted trees,which provide shade and a natural buffer between the dog
park and the City Hall Campus.
This project was in the budget for 2013 at$10,000 but did not get completed.
